Get started24 Park Road is a five-bedroom semi-detached house in Teddington (TW11 0AQ). It has a recorded floor area of 236 m² (around 2540 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band G. It is a listed building, which means external alterations are tightly controlled but it may qualify for heritage tax reliefs. The latest certificate (September 2023) shows a D (score 65),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. When first surveyed in August 2009 the rating was F, the property has climbed 2 bands since. Between certificates, window efficiency went from Very Poor to Poor, hot-water efficiency went from Very Poor to Good and lighting went from Good to Very Good.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 82), a 2-band jump.
At 236 m² the property is well over the postcode median (46 m² across 20 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. On energy efficiency it sits in the bottom 10% of properties in this postcode — significant headroom for improvement. 5 bedrooms is on the larger side for this postcode, where 3 is the typical count. Today's modelled estimate of £1,875,000 sits 50% above the 2011 sale of £1,250,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£492/sq ft) was about 98.5% above the typical sold price in the postcode. 12 planning records sit against the property, 2 approved, 0 refused. Past consents include new windows,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. On the market in August 2011 and unlisted since — roughly 15 years.
